Over the past day, the situation in the Joint Force Operation area in eastern Ukraine remained difficult. The intensive fighting continued throughout the contact line.

The units of the joint forces did not allow the enemy to improve its tactical positions, the Joint Forces Operation Headquarters press center reports.

"The tensest situation was observed near Avdiivka (18km north of Donetsk), Pisky (12km north-west of Donetsk), Shyrokyne (20km east of Mariupol). Russian-occupation troops fired artillery and mortars 20 times. Small arms, grenade launchers, weapons on infantry fighting vehicles were used 53 times to shell Ukrainian positions," the report reads.

The units of the joint forces carried out active military operations in the area of Avdiivka industrial zone, the village of Piske, gave an adequate response and destroyed the enemy’s firepower.

According to intelligence, five militants were killed and another seven were wounded just in Avdiivka direction.

During the current day, May 10, the fighting is ongoing in Donetsk and Mariupol directions. No casualties among Ukrainian troops have been reported.
